Selection criteria for noninvasive ventilation candidates |
| Conscious and cooperative patient (the patient with chronic obstructive pulmonary
disease may be an exception) |
| No need for urgent intubation to protect the airways or to remove copious secretions |
| No acute facial trauma (helmet interface may permit an exception in selected cases) |
| No recent gastroesophageal surgery |
| No active gastrointestinal bleeding |
| No impairment in swallowing |
| Hemodynamic and rhythm stability |
| Adequate fitting of the interface |
